What Is PDRN and Why Is It Used in Medical Aesthetics?

Definition of Polydeoxyribonucleotide (PDRN)

PDRN refers to low-molecular-weight DNA fragments, most commonly derived from salmon PDRN through controlled extraction and purification processes. These DNA fragments typically fall within a refined molecular weight range suitable for topical and professional-use formulations, without entering pharmaceutical territory.

One of the key reasons PDRN has attracted attention is its high homology to human DNA, which contributes to its compatibility in skin-focused applications. Rather than acting as a harsh active, PDRN functions as a supportive, bio-derived ingredient that aligns well with natural skin processes.

Why Salmon PDRN Is Preferred

Among available sources, salmon PDRN is widely preferred in medical aesthetics due to several practical advantages:

Purity and consistency: Salmon-derived PDRN allows for standardized molecular profiles.

Biocompatibility: Its natural origin supports gentle interaction with skin.

Traceability and safety control: Reliable sourcing and refined manufacturing ensure quality stability.

How PDRN Works in Skin Repair and Regeneration

Cellular Support and Nucleotide Supply

From a formulation perspective, PDRN is valued for its role in supporting cellular metabolism. By supplying nucleic acid components, it provides essential building blocks that assist normal skin renewal processes. This makes it particularly suitable for products designed for recovery, maintenance, and regeneration-focused skincare.

Rather than forcing visible changes, PDRN works in harmony with the skin’s natural turnover cycle, which is why it is often included in professional recovery products.

Skin Barrier Repair Mechanism

A healthy skin barrier is central to overall skin quality. PDRN barrier repair applications focus on supporting epidermal renewal and reinforcing the skin’s protective function. In formulations, PDRN is often positioned as a supportive ingredient that helps improve the condition of weakened or stressed skin barriers, especially following environmental stress or aesthetic procedures.

Key PDRN Applications in Medical Aesthetics

PDRN for Skin Repair and Post-Procedure Recovery

One of the most established PDRN applications is skin repair following aesthetic treatments. PDRN-containing products are often used:

After aesthetic or cosmetic procedures

For skin that appears stressed, dry, or imbalanced

In these contexts, PDRN supports recovery-oriented skincare routines and complements professional treatment protocols.

Anti-Aging and Skin Rejuvenation Applications

In anti-aging and skin rejuvenation, PDRN is frequently included to support overall skin appearance and elasticity. Rather than positioning it as a single-solution ingredient, formulators often combine PDRN with:

Peptides

Hyaluronic acid (HA)

Soothing or conditioning agents

This synergistic approach aligns well with modern medical aesthetics, where balanced formulations are preferred over aggressive actives.

PDRN Barrier Repair for Sensitive Skin

For sensitive skin lines, PDRN barrier repair products are commonly positioned as calming and recovery-focused solutions. These formulations aim to help maintain skin homeostasis, supporting comfort and resilience without irritation.

Emerging Uses in Scalp and Hair Care

Beyond facial skincare, PDRN is increasingly explored in scalp and hair care applications. It is often included in formulations designed to support scalp health and overall hair condition. In professional settings, PDRN-based scalp products are commonly paired with soothing and conditioning ingredients, making them suitable for ongoing care routines.

PDRN in Formulations: Products and Delivery Formats

Common Product Types

In medical aesthetics and professional skincare, PDRN appears in a wide range of delivery formats, including:

Serums and ampoules for concentrated care

Repair creams and masks for barrier support

Professional-use solutions for clinic or treatment-room application

This versatility makes PDRN adaptable across both professional and consumer-facing products.

Compatibility With Other Active Ingredients

Another advantage of PDRN is its excellent formulation compatibility. It is commonly combined with:

Peptides for multi-functional support

Hyaluronic acid for hydration-focused products

Soothing and barrier-supporting ingredients

For formulators and product developers, this flexibility simplifies integration into existing product lines.

Safety, Quality, and Regulatory Considerations

Purity and Manufacturing Standards

High-quality salmon PDRN depends on controlled extraction and refinement processes. Professional-grade materials typically follow strict quality control indicators such as molecular consistency, purity, and stability. These standards are essential for ensuring reliable performance across batches.

Safety Profile in Aesthetic Use

In aesthetic applications, PDRN is widely recognized as non-hormonal and suitable for professional skincare use. It is commonly found in products designed for repeated or long-term application, reflecting its favorable safety profile when manufactured to appropriate standards.
